Connectivity IC specialist Oxford Semiconductor has opened a new office in Taipei to provide local commercial and technical support to the company's rapidly expanding Greater China market.

Buoyant sales of its FireWire/IDE bridge ICs and UART products have seen Oxford Semiconductor experience strong continuous growth in the region since the company established its Singapore office in 2000.

"This exciting move acknowledges the pivotal role Taiwan is playing in the development of our key consumer electronics markets", said William Wong.

"As well as helping to improve local customer service, the Taiwan office will provide us with the market intelligence we need to proactively respond to rapidly changing customer demands".
